学习编程技术主要是为了1、软件开发、2、数据分析、3、网页设计与开发、4、人工智能及机器学习。在这些领域中,软件开发扮演着基础而重要的角色。它涉及到使用编程语言来创建、测试、维护软件应用程序。软件开发不仅仅是编程,它还包括理解用户需求、设计软件解决方案以及持续更新软件以满足新的需求或修复存在的问题。这一职能领域为编程技能提供了广阔的应用平台,要求开发者不断学习新的编程语言和技术,以适应技术发展的快速变化。
一、软件开发
软件开发是将编程技术应用得最为广泛的领域之一。开发者利用编程语言如Python、Java等,构建各类应用程序,从桌面软件到移动应用,乃至复杂的企业系统。软件开发过程中,开发者不仅要编写高效、可读的代码,还需遵循软件工程的原则,进行系统设计、测试、部署等一系列流程,确保软件质量。
二、数据分析
数据分析侧重于使用编程技术对大量数据进行收集、处理和分析,以得出有价值的信息和趋势。Python和R语言是数据分析中常用的工具,配合相关的库和框架,如Pandas、NumPy、SciPy,在金融、市场研究、生物信息学等领域得到广泛应用。通过编程技术,数据分析师可以自动化复杂的数据处理任务,有效支持决策过程。
三、网页设计与开发
网页设计与开发是另一个重要领域,它关注于创建功能完备、外观吸引的网站和网页应用。使用HTML, CSS 和 JavaScript 等技术,开发者能够构建响应式、交互式的网页。随着现代Web开发技术的进步,比如React、Vue、Angular等框架的出现,开发复杂的单页面应用(SPA)变得更加高效。
四、人工智能及机器学习
人工智能及机器学习是编程技术的前沿领域,涉及到算法、模型构建、数据处理等多个技术层面。通过编程语言如Python开发的机器学习库(如TensorFlow、PyTorch),允许开发者构建自动识别模式、进行预测的智能系统。应用范围广泛,包括图像识别、自然语言处理、推荐系统等。
掌握编程技术不仅可以开启软件开发的职业道路,还能深入数据分析、网页设计与开发、甚至是前沿的人工智能及机器学习领域。每个领域都有其独特的挑战和机遇,要求持续的学习和实践。无论是追求技术深度,还是希望在跨领域有所成就,编程技术都是实现目标的重要途径,开启了技术创新和应用开发的广阔天地。
相关问答FAQs:
学习编程技术可以为您提供什么样的职业机会?
学习编程技术将为您打开广阔的职业发展机会。在今天的数字化时代,计算机科学和编程已经渗透到各行各业,并成为了许多行业中的核心竞争力。无论是在技术行业还是非技术行业,掌握编程技术都将使您在就业市场上拥有更大的竞争力。
以下是几个学习编程技术所能带来的职业机会:
-
软件开发工程师:您可以成为一名专业的软件开发工程师,负责开发、测试和维护软件应用程序。这是计算机科学领域最常见的职业之一,也是最受欢迎的职业之一。
-
数据分析师:学习编程技术还可以帮助您成为一名数据分析师。随着大数据的兴起,数据分析师的需求越来越大。掌握编程技术使您能够处理和分析大量数据,并从中提取有用的信息。
-
网络安全专家:随着网络攻击和数据泄露事件的增加,网络安全专家的需求也在不断增加。学习编程技术可以帮助您理解网络安全原理,并开发和实施安全解决方案,保护机构或企业的网络安全。
-
人工智能工程师:随着人工智能技术的发展,对人工智能工程师的需求也在快速增长。学习编程技术可以帮助您掌握机器学习和深度学习等人工智能技术领域的知识,从事人工智能相关的开发和研究工作。
-
创业家:学习编程技术还可以帮助您成为一名创业家。如果您有创业的热情和创新的想法,掌握编程技术将使您能够开发和推出自己的创新产品或服务。
总之,学习编程技术将为您提供广阔的职业发展机会,无论是在技术行业还是非技术行业。只要您掌握了编程技术,您将成为市场上备受追捧的人才。
文章标题:学编程技术为了什么工作,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/1620018